CVE-2017-14687
HighSummary
Artifex MuPDF version 1.11 allows attackers to cause a denial of service or possibly have unspecified other impact via a crafted .xps file. The issue arises from mishandling of XML tag name comparisons.

Original NVD description (English source)
Artifex MuPDF 1.11 allows attackers to cause a denial of service or possibly have unspecified other impact via a crafted .xps file, related to "Data from Faulting Address controls Branch Selection starting at mupdf+0x000000000016cb4f" on Windows. This occurs because of mishandling of XML tag name comparisons.
